Good In-tent-ions

croatiantimes.com

Loyal son Chen Luxue has converted his car into a bizarre mobile home to take his 100-year-old mum in a 3,000 mile road trip across China.

The saloon - which even has a loo in the boot - has been turned into a duplex home with the back seats cleared out to make a bed for mum Hen Li Zu.

And on the first floor on a roof rack is an adapted tent for Chen, 67, and his wife Lin, from Shuangliu, Sichuan province, southern China.

"I am retired now so I have the time and some money to take my mother to see places in this country that she has never seen before before she dies.

"She is a great age and we have to make the most of the time we have," he explained.
